Origin
- Tea type
- Dark
- Alt Names
- Ān Chá (安茶, Ānchá), Liú An Lán Chá (六安篮茶, Liù'ān Lánchá — "Lu'an basket tea"), Ruǎnzhī Chá (软枝茶, Ruǎnzhī Chá ...
- Climate
- Subtropical monsoon with clearly defined seasons. Average annual temperature 15–16°C, abundant precipitation (1600–1800 mm in Qimen), high humidity and prolonged fogs.
- Soil
- Red, yellow, and yellow-brown soils (红壤, 黄壤, 黄棕壤), pH 4.5–5.5, with sufficient organic matter content. Rich mineral composition of mountain soils promotes accumulation of aromat...
Taste
- Dry Leaf Appearance
- Tightly twisted, somewhat coarse leaves of dark green, olive-black color with oily luster. In aged specimens — black with chocolate tint. Characteristic packaging in bamboo bask...
- Liquor Aroma
- Rich, multi-layered. Woody, nutty notes, dried fruits, light floral background. In young tea — more "green," herbal aromatics; with aging — deepening toward "chen...
- Liquor Color
- From amber-orange (young tea) to deep red-chestnut (aged). Clear, bright.
- Spent Leaves
- Dark olive to brown-red, leaf veins often with reddish tint. Leaf elastic, expands well.

Details
- Picking
- Mid to late April — mid-May, around the Gǔyǔ period (谷雨, "Grain Rain"), strictly within approximately 10 days. This is one of the narrowest harvest "windows"...
- Pluck Standard
- 1 bud + 2 leaves (一芽二叶, yī yá èr yè), 1 bud + 3 leaves (一芽三叶, yī yá sān yè) or opposite leaves (对夹叶, duìjiā yè) — for "Mao Jian" (毛尖...
- Raw Material
- Leaves must be whole, fresh, without mechanical damage or foreign odors. Despite belonging to hei cha, raw material for An Cha is substantially more tender than for most dark te...
- Alkaloids
- Caffeine (咖啡碱), theobromine (可可碱) — standard tea levels. Caffeine content moderate due to raw material maturity and prolonged processing.
- Amino Acids
- L-theanine (L-茶氨酸) and other amino acids — content depends on raw material tenderness; in "Gong Jian" grade — elevated.
- Minerals
- Potassium, magnesium, fluorine, zinc, manganese — enrichment determined by mountain soils.
